Citroen Aircross X: Book Now, What’s New

Citroen Aircross X bookings are open across India with a token amount of ₹11,000. This is the brand’s next feature-led update after the C3 X and Basalt X. The Citroen Aircross X gets buyer-critical features like cruise control and an optional 360-degree camera while keeping the powertrains intact for a familiar driving experience.

Design and exterior

Aircross X retains the core silhouette of the standard model but gets a new dark green colour and an ‘X’ badge on the tailgate to signify the update. Teaser images and reports also suggests dual-tone alloys for a subtle differentiation without changing the SUV’s dimensions or stance.

Features: Cruise control and Cara AI

Inside, it’s all about everyday usability upgrades led by cruise control, a long pending request for highway comfort. Expect push-button start/stop, white ambient lighting, leatherette-wrapped dashboard and an optional 360-degree camera; higher trims will get Citroen’s Cara AI for voice control and vehicle insights.

Engine and performance

No mechanical changes expected with the Aircross X update, just like the X-series strategy. The SUV continues with the 1.2-litre NA petrol and 1.2-litre turbo-petrol, 82 hp/115 Nm and 110 hp/190-205 Nm respectively depending on the transmission.

Aircross X price and booking

Positioned as a new top-spec variant, the Aircross X will be priced at a premium over the current range, which starts from ₹8.62 Lakh. While the exact on-road price will be announced at launch, it is expected to be competitive against rivals given the recent GST price cuts on the entire Citroen lineup. Bookings open at ₹11,000 and full price and variant details will be out in a few weeks.

Citroen’s “X” strategy in India

Aircross X follows the C3 X and Basalt X template: add high-impact features, keep powertrains and sharpen value to compete harder in the C-SUV space. With GST-related price adjustments making the entire range more affordable, this feature-led update targets stronger showroom pull without a mechanical overhaul.
